Ājñāyin is a word in the Sanskrit language where it represents a Noun. This page shows the declension shemes of the possible gender(s) including the grammatical case and number. Note that Sanskrit has eight cases, three numbers and three different genders. The Sanskrit noun Ājñāyin is found in masculine and neuter form. These declensions are also used for the adjectives.

Masculine declension scheme:
This is the Masculine declension of the word Ājñāyin following the rules for -in.
masculine in-stem declension for 'Ājñāyin'
single | dual | plural | |
---|---|---|---|
nominative. | ājñāyī | ājñāyinau | ājñāyinaḥ |
accusative. | ājñāyinam | ājñāyinau | ājñāyinaḥ |
instrumental. | ājñāyinā | ājñāyibhyām | ājñāyibhiḥ |
dative. | ājñāyine | ājñāyibhyām | ājñāyibhyaḥ |
ablative. | ājñāyinaḥ | ājñāyibhyām | ājñāyibhyaḥ |
genitive. | ājñāyinaḥ | ājñāyinoḥ | ājñāyinām |
locative. | ājñāyini | ājñāyinoḥ | ājñāyiṣu |
vocative. | ājñāyin | ājñāyinau | ājñāyinaḥ |
Compound: | ājñāyi- | ||
Adverb: | -ājñāyi |
Neuter declension scheme:
This is the Neuter declension of the word Ājñāyin following the rules for -in.
neuter in-stem declension for 'Ājñāyin'
single | dual | plural | |
---|---|---|---|
nominative. | ājñāyi | ājñāyinī | ājñāyīni |
accusative. | ājñāyi | ājñāyinī | ājñāyīni |
instrumental. | ājñāyinā | ājñāyibhyām | ājñāyibhiḥ |
dative. | ājñāyine | ājñāyibhyām | ājñāyibhyaḥ |
ablative. | ājñāyinaḥ | ājñāyibhyām | ājñāyibhyaḥ |
genitive. | ājñāyinaḥ | ājñāyinoḥ | ājñāyinām |
locative. | ājñāyini | ājñāyinoḥ | ājñāyiṣu |
vocative. | ājñāyin | ājñāyi | ājñāyinī | ājñāyīni |
Compound: | ājñāyi- | ||
Adverb: | -ājñāyi |
